2025年区块链应用开发工程师考试题库(附答案和详细解析)(1202).docxVIP

2025年区块链应用开发工程师考试题库(附答案和详细解析)(1202).docx

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

区块链应用开发工程师考试试卷

一、单项选择题(共10题,每题1分,共10分)

以下哪种共识算法适用于需要快速达成共识且节点身份可验证的联盟链场景?

A.工作量证明(PoW)

B.权益证明(PoS)

C.实用拜占庭容错(PBFT)

D.容量证明(PoSpace)

答案:C

解析:PBFT通过节点间消息传递和投票机制达成共识,适用于节点数量有限、身份可验证的联盟链(如HyperledgerFabric);PoW(A)依赖算力竞争,能耗高;PoS(B)基于持币量随机选择验证者,适合公链;PoSpace(D)依赖存储空间,常见于Chia等项目。

智能合约的“可组合性”主要指?

A.支持多种编程语言开发

B.不同合约间可通过接口调用实现功能组合

C.合约代码可跨区块链平台复用

D.合约部署后可动态修改代码

答案:B

解析:可组合性(Composability)是区块链的核心特性,指智能合约可通过调用其他合约的接口(如ERC-20的transfer函数)实现功能扩展(如DeFi协议中的借贷+交易组合);A是开发灵活性,C涉及跨链兼容性,D违背区块链不可篡改性(合约部署后代码通常不可修改)。

比特币采用的UTXO模型与以太坊账户模型的主要区别是?

A.UTXO模型无状态,账户模型维护余额状态

B.UTXO模型支持智能合约,账户模型不支持

C.UTXO模型基于公钥,账户模型基于地址

D.UTXO模型可无限拆分,账户模型不可拆分

答案:A

解析:UTXO(未花费交易输出)模型中,每笔交易由多个输入(已存在的UTXO)和输出(新的UTXO)组成,无全局账户余额状态;账户模型(如以太坊)维护每个地址的余额和状态变量(如存储、代码);B错误(UTXO不直接支持复杂合约),C错误(两者均基于公钥/地址),D错误(两者均可拆分)。

以下哪项是哈希函数的关键特性?

A.输入可变长,输出固定长

B.可从哈希值逆推原始输入

C.不同输入可能生成相同哈希值(碰撞)

D.输入微小变化不会影响哈希值

答案:A

解析:哈希函数的核心特性包括:输入可变长、输出固定长(如SHA-256输出256位);抗碰撞性(C错误,理想哈希无碰撞);单向性(B错误,无法逆推);雪崩效应(D错误,输入微小变化会导致哈希值大幅变化)。

跨链技术中,“中继链”的主要作用是?

A.直接复制目标链的全部交易数据

B.验证并传递不同链间的状态信息

C.统一不同链的共识算法

D.替代主链处理所有跨链交易

答案:B

解析:中继链(如Polkadot的RelayChain)通过轻客户端或验证者节点,验证并传递不同平行链间的状态证明(如资产锁定/解锁信息),实现跨链通信;A错误(仅传递关键证明而非全部数据),C错误(不统一共识),D错误(主链仍处理本链交易)。

区块链钱包的“助记词”本质是?

A.公钥的明文表示

B.私钥的派生种子

C.地址的哈希值

D.交易的签名数据

答案:B

解析:助记词(如BIP-39标准)是通过12-24个单词生成的种子短语,用于派生钱包的私钥、公钥和地址;A错误(公钥由私钥生成),C错误(地址由公钥哈希生成),D错误(签名由私钥对交易数据生成)。

DApp(去中心化应用)的核心组件不包括?

A.智能合约(运行在链上)

B.前端界面(运行在客户端)

C.中心化服务器(存储用户数据)

D.区块链网络(提供共识与存储)

答案:C

解析:DApp的核心是链上智能合约(逻辑与数据存储)、客户端前端(用户交互)和区块链网络(底层支撑);中心化服务器(C)违背“去中心化”原则,DApp通常使用IPFS等分布式存储替代。

零知识证明(ZKP)的典型应用场景是?

A.验证交易合法性但不泄露交易细节

B.提高区块链的交易吞吐量

C.替代哈希函数生成区块头

D.实现跨链资产的1:1映射

答案:A

解析:ZKP允许证明者在不泄露关键信息的情况下向验证者证明某个命题成立(如“我拥有某资产但不暴露具体金额”),常见于隐私交易(如Zcash的屏蔽交易);B是扩容技术(如Layer2)的作用,C错误(哈希函数仍用于区块头),D是跨链桥的功能。

以下哪种攻击方式专门针对智能合约的“重入漏洞”?

A.攻击者多次调用合约函数,在状态更新前重复转账

B.向合约发送大量无效交易耗尽Gas

C.通过51%攻击双花资产

D.伪造交易签名绕过身份验证

答案:A

解析:重入漏洞(Reentrancy)指合约在未完成状态更新(如余额扣减)前,允许外部合约通过回调函数重复调用转账逻辑(如DAO攻击事件);B是Gas耗尽攻击,C是共识层攻击,D是签名伪造攻击。

以太坊的“Gas”机制主要用于?

A.奖励矿工打包交易

B.限制交易的字节长度

C.防止合约

文档评论(0)

191****0055 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档